Patrick Long is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Social Psychology and Demography. According to data from OpenAlex, Patrick Long has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 3.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 21 papers in Social Psychology and 7 papers in Demography. Recurrent topics in Patrick Long’s work include Recreation, Leisure, Wilderness Management (21 papers), Diverse Aspects of Tourism Research (19 papers) and Sport and Mega-Event Impacts (12 papers). Patrick Long is often cited by papers focused on Recreation, Leisure, Wilderness Management (21 papers), Diverse Aspects of Tourism Research (19 papers) and Sport and Mega-Event Impacts (12 papers). Patrick Long coll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and South Korea. Patrick Long's co-authors include Richard R. Perdue, Lawrence R. Allen, Sara Dolničar, Geoffrey I. Crouch, Nancy Gard McGehee, B. Bynum Boley, Soo K. Kang, Choong‐Ki Lee, Yvette Reisinger and Yooshik Yoon and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Business Research, Tourism Management and Bulletin of the American Meteorological Society.
